Output 871bb6e9881afa718b50d27449a32935734a0c1ad41525a6218994fa8fea2692:32

value
11715826
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8cf18998ee8a912253b714e390d59d910add5fad OP_EQUALVERIFY OP_CHECKSIG
address
1DrExBAb96bcYBSLeJ9g3ENY6WvAYB8MjR
transaction
871bb6e9881afa718b50d27449a32935734a0c1ad41525a6218994fa8fea2692
spent
true